Output 1350796d099cb89a1927b8c73c7f6310a166a6f0e8269af844faa8fc7194890f:537

value
378504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3dfa40f4258472e96d50c75f5f4e3e33df95ad7 OP_EQUAL
address
3M1JQrnZjdAyQ377QvH4Y3QtmFA1iSGLsB
transaction
1350796d099cb89a1927b8c73c7f6310a166a6f0e8269af844faa8fc7194890f
spent
true